Original Description
Jean-Léon Gérôme’s Die Boten des Paschas (Study for the Painting) is a mesmerizing glimpse into the 19th-century Orientalist movement, capturing the allure and mystique of the Middle Eastern world. The painting exudes an air of exotic drama, with richly detailed figures clad in vibrant robes delivering urgent messages—likely emissaries of a powerful pasha. Gérôme’s meticulous realism and sharp attention to texture—be it the sheen of silk or the ruggedness of desert terrain—immerse viewers in a vividly staged moment. As one of the leading figures of Academic art, Gérôme blends historical narrative with almost photographic precision, a hallmark of his work that solidified his reputation in both Salon exhibitions and art history. While Orientalism remains controversial today for its romanticized Western gaze, this study exemplifies Gérôme’s mastery of composition and storytelling, offering a compelling snapshot of a bygone era’s fascination with the "Orient."
